2024 Mazda CX-80 fuel consumption
3 versions rated. Official figures from the Australian Government’s Green Vehicle Guide.
Fuel use, combined
2.7–8.4 L/100km
lower is better
Cost to run a year
$1,697–$2,176
at 14,000km
CO₂ from the exhaust
64–197 g/km
per kilometre
Uses 66% less fuel than the typical 2024 car, which averaged 7.9 L/100km.
Every 2024 Mazda CX-80 version
| Version | Engine | Fuel use | City | Highway | Cost/year | CO₂ |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| SUV Auto | 2.5L 4cyl Plug-in Electric/Petrol 91RON | 2.7 | – | – | $1,697 | 64 Better than average |
| SUV Auto | 3.3L 6cyl Turbo Diesel | 5.2 | 5.6 | 5.1 | $1,740 | 137 Better than average |
| SUV Auto | 3.3L 6cyl Turbo Petrol 91RON | 8.4 | 11.7 | 6.5 | $2,176 | 197 Slightly worse than average |

Figures come from a standardised laboratory test, so every car is measured the same way. Your own fuel use will differ with traffic, load, tyre pressure and how you drive. Running costs assume 14,000km a year at recent average fuel prices.
